Output ec0d4fee7323b689856b2393aecd39a8987f269a821860a643ca98718a7f1d2c:38

value
13608
script pubkey
OP_0 OP_PUSHBYTES_20 e43b43eb1e00c08bec4673a58143729d4dfe4a4a
address
bc1qusa586c7qrqghmzxwwjczsmjn4xlujj24na493
transaction
ec0d4fee7323b689856b2393aecd39a8987f269a821860a643ca98718a7f1d2c
spent
true